What this test is

Breast ultrasound is the first imaging done for a palpable breast lump, especially in women under 40 (where mammography is less informative due to dense breast tissue). It distinguishes between cysts and solid lumps, evaluates lump characteristics, and checks the axillary lymph nodes. Always performed by our female sonographer with a female attendant present.

When you need this test

  • Palpable breast lump
  • Breast pain or skin changes
  • Discharge from nipple
  • Family history of breast cancer
  • Follow-up of a previously identified cyst

How to prepare

  • No fasting required.
  • Avoid using deodorant, talc, or lotion on the chest area on the day of the scan.
  • Wear a two-piece outfit.
  • Mention any previous breast scans, mammograms, or family history of breast cancer.

FAQs

  • Ultrasound or mammogram?
    Under 40, ultrasound is preferred (denser breast tissue makes mammogram less useful). Over 40, both are often done together.

  • Will biopsy be needed?
    Only if the ultrasound finding is suspicious (BIRADS 4 or 5). Most lumps in women under 40 are benign cysts or fibroadenomas.
